waon
« Back to VersTracker
Description:
Wave-to-notes transcriber
Type: Formula  |  Tracked Since: Dec 28, 2025
Links: Homepage  |  formulae.brew.sh
Category: Multimedia
Tags: audio midi music signal-processing cli
Install: brew install waon
About:
Waon is a command-line utility that converts audio signals (like WAV files) into MIDI notes using Fast Fourier Transform analysis. It effectively transcribes monophonic pitch data from recordings of single-voiced instruments or humming into editable musical notation. This tool is valuable for musicians and developers needing to extract melodic data from analog sources for use in digital audio workstations.
Key Features:
  • FFT-based pitch detection for accurate frequency analysis
  • Converts WAV audio files directly to MIDI format
  • Command-line interface suitable for batch processing
  • Supports ALSA and JACK for Linux audio integration
Use Cases:
  • Transcribing melodies from hummed or played recordings
  • Analyzing pitch contours in audio research
  • Converting single-instrument audio tracks to MIDI for editing
Alternatives:
  • aubiopitch – Part of the aubio library, offering more modern pitch detection algorithms and Python bindings.
  • sox – A general-purpose audio utility that can perform pitch shifting but lacks dedicated transcription to MIDI.
Version History
Detected Version Rev Change Commit